Durham's day-to-day fact for dogs

Our climate swings. July and August bring lengthy strings of days above 90 degrees with pavement that french fries paws quickly. Plant pollen spikes can cause impulse flare in springtime. We likewise get cold snaps with freezing rainfall that turn sidewalks unsafe. Great pet walkers plan around all of it. They start previously in warm, usage shaded greenways like Sandy Creek Park, lug water, switch to sniffy decompression strolls in tree cover, and shorten lunchtime stretches if required. When ice hits, they pick more secure courses, wipe paws, and look for salt irritation.

The built environment shapes options too. Midtown has tighter sidewalks and even more sound. Woodcroft and Hope Valley deal calmer dead ends and loopholes with mature trees. The American Cigarette Route is superb for straight, constant gas mileage, however it can be busy with bikes. A savvy dog walker reads the map, then reviews your canine, and integrates both to obtain the ideal sort of exercise.

The leading seven advantages of employing a specialist dog walker in Durham

1. Constant, breed suitable exercise that fits the season

Every dog requires motion, yet not the same kind or dose. A 9 year old bulldog does not require what a 10 month old Aussie demands. A specialist canine walking service brings that calibration. In summer, my walkers in Durham shift high drive herding breeds to unethical, quit and smell courses near Third Fork Creek in the late morning, after that do any type of aerobic work in the cooler evening port. Senior dogs obtain short, constant potty breaks with gentle walks and rest. On light loss days, we extend duration and surface, utilizing leaf litter and brand-new scents as mind work. Over a month, that equilibrium of intensity and rest improves stamina without overloading joints or getting too hot, specifically crucial on humid days that compromise cooling.

2. Midday relief, much healthier digestion, fewer accidents

Gastrointestinal convenience and bladder wellness enhance with regular alleviation. Puppies under 6 months rarely make it longer than 4 hours without a break, no matter how much you desire they could. Lots of grown-up pets can hold it, however at a price, particularly senior citizens or those on particular medications. Trustworthy midday strolls decrease urinary tract infection risk and aid regulate bowel movements. In my notes, houses with a regular 20 to 30 minute midday stroll saw indoor mishaps go down to near absolutely no within 2 weeks, also for lately embraced pets that were still settling in. That predictability reduces anxiety and prevents the sort of frenzied power that constructs when a dog needs to wait too long.

3. Better behavior with targeted psychological work

A tired dog is a misconception if all you do is run them up until their legs wobble. The mind needs a job. Excellent pet dog walkers make use of scent games at trailheads, pattern video games at silent corners, and easy impulse control on chain to bring arousal down, after that maintain it there. We will certainly request for a sit and eye get in touch with at hectic crosswalks on Ninth Street, reward calm while a bus goes by, and tip off the walkway for area if a skateboard approaches. Ten intentional repeatings done well matter greater than a frantic mile. Gradually, pulling reduces, reactivity softens, and your pet discovers just how to recuperate from abrupt sound or groups. That repays in reality, like outdoor dishes at Geer Road or waiting in line at a veterinarian clinic.

4. Social confidence without chaos

Everyone images their pet going for a park with a lots new good friends. Some grow there, some obtain overloaded, and a few find out poor behaviors quickly. Expert dog walkers in Durham, NC manage social exposure tactically. If a canine delights in business, we couple suitable walking pals by size, power, and leash manners, keep teams small, and pick paths with sufficient size for comfy side-by-side motion, like areas of Duke Woodland where permitted. For dogs that choose room, we set up solo strolls and course them at off peak times. The result is social self-confidence improved favorable, regulated experiences, not compelled proximity.

5. Early detection of health problems and more secure walks

Walkers hang out seeing your pet dog move, sniff, and remove on a daily basis. That repeating exposes tiny changes. We discover the head bob that suggests a sore wrist, a brand-new drawback in the hips on stairs, the means a normally steady stomach produces soft stool two days running. A text with a quick video clip usually triggers a preventive vet visit that saves bigger trouble later on. Security understanding expands beyond the dog. Durham has city wildlife, from hawks to the strange coyote sighting at dawn near wooded edges. We maintain canines on leash per local policies, scan for foxtails and burrs, carry tick cleaners, and stay clear of warm asphalt at midday. I have actually rescheduled strolls to shaded loops much more times than I can count when a heat advisory hit, and proprietors thanked me later.

6. Real benefit for difficult schedules

Shifts transform. A conference runs long. A kid gets up with a fever. A pet walking solution takes in that unpredictability. A lot of established dog pedestrians in Durham use timetable home windows, same day add ons if you book early, and application based updates. You obtain a GPS map, a few photos, and a short note about state of mind, poop, and anything notable. Also if you remain in a laboratory or rubbed in, you can glance at your phone and recognize your canine is covered. The mental lift is genuine. Customers usually claim the updates aid them concentrate at the workplace, after that stroll in the door prepared to appreciate the evening instead of scramble to take care of a mess.

7. A calmer home life

When a pet dog's needs are satisfied accurately, they bark less at squirrels, eat less shoes, and settle faster after dinner. That changes the feeling of your house. I consider one pair in Trinity Park whose young vizsla wailed whenever they left. We established a thirty minutes sniff stroll at 11, then a 15 minute potty break with 2 short training video games at 3. Within three weeks, their neighbors quit texting concerning noise. They began inviting buddies over once again. The pet dog learned that every day has beats, and stress and anxiety shed its grip.

What a professional pet walking service typically provides in Durham

Service menus differ, but you will see patterns throughout the far better pet dog walking solutions in Durham, NC. Basic browse through sizes float at 20, 30, and 60 minutes. Some use 45 minutes, which functions well in severe weather condition or for dogs that do finest with a quick loophole and a couple of minutes of indoor play. Many companies use a scheduling app that verifies time home windows, logs the walk route, and lets you upgrade feeding or drug notes.

Solo walks suit reactive, elderly, or medically complex canines. Paired or tiny team walks can decrease price and add safe social time, but ask what group size means in method. I seldom see greater than two pets per pedestrian on city walkways. 3 is a tough limit I suggest for tracks with wide paths. Off chain experiences sound amazing, yet true off leash is rare in Durham as a result of leash legislations and security. A trustworthy dog walker will certainly maintain your dog leashed unless on private property with authorization, and they will tell you that up front.

Expect fundamental gear management, like cleaning paws after rainfall, refreshing water, and towel drying if needed. A midday dog walk lot of walkers lug a small set, poop bags, spare slip lead, a collapsible water dish, and paw balm in winter season. Keys are kept in lockboxes or coded systems, and insurance coverage needs to cover essential loss. If your pet needs noontime medicine, verify the solution's plan on administering tablets or drops. Numerous will certainly do it, but they will certainly desire a signed instruction sheet and perhaps a quick demo.

Pricing in context, and what influences it

Rates move with experience, insurance, and browse through size. In Durham, a 20 min visit typically lands in between 18 and 28 dollars, a half an hour see between 22 and 35 dollars, and a 60 minute visit between 35 and 55 bucks. Add ons like a 2nd dog can be a tiny charge, commonly 3 to 8 dollars, depending on the size and taking care of requirements. Weekend break, vacation, or late night slots might bring surcharges. Solo reactive pet getaways set you back more than a relaxed paired walk, not since anyone is punishing the dog, however since 2 hands, 2 eyes, and a broad barrier are devoted to one animal.

Be cautious of prices that appear also low. Workers require training, time extra padding for emergencies, and rest. A lasting dog strolling solution pays rather, preserves insurance coverage, and can absorb the periodic blowout without canceling your pet's day.

How to select the very best dog walker in Durham, NC

Plenty of search engine result appear when you type dog walker Durham NC. Arranging them takes judgment, and you do not require an advanced degree to do it well. Beginning with insurance and experience, after that see just how a walker communicates with your pet dog and with you. Pay attention to the small points, like preparation at the meet and greet and the quality of their communication. Request referrals from clients with pets comparable to yours, not just glowing generalities.

Here is a portable list that keeps the essentials front and facility:

  • Proof of company insurance coverage, bonding, and employees' settlement if they have employees, plus a clear plan for tricks or lockboxes.
  • Training method that uses benefits and humane handling, with specifics on how they take care of pulling, barking, or sudden lunges.
  • Experience with your canine's profile, as an example, large adolescent dogs, elders with joint inflammation, or leash reactive dogs.
  • Clear go to structure, timing windows, and back-up plan if your primary walker is sick or stuck, with general practitioner or picture updates.
  • Transparent prices, termination terms, holiday additional charges, and exactly how they deal with severe warmth, tornados, or ice.

When you satisfy, view your canine. A good walker gives a pet dog area to smell and approach initially, stoops laterally rather than impending, and avoids harsh patting right away. They deal with chains efficiently, check harness fit, and ask where your dog suches as to go. If your pet dog is reluctant or reactive, a silent initial check out with no stress to walk much may be the right call.

Local context that matters greater than you think

Durham and bordering districts enforce leash and pet dog waste pickup policies. An expert should state this without triggering. Ask how they course on warm days, wet days, and throughout fallen leave pickup when walkways obtain blocked. In summertime, shaded routes along creeks or in older areas with high trees make an actual distinction for brachycephalic breeds. In wintertime, some sidewalks stay icy long after the sun hits others, particularly on north encountering hillsides. People who walk daily in your component of community understand where the safe ground is.

Traffic timing is another peaceful element. Around schools, dismissal home windows develop clusters of automobiles and kids with scooters, which can startle noise sensitive dogs. A walker who understands to move 20 minutes previously that week deserves their fee.

Interview questions and five refined red flags

You will have your own listing of questions. Add a couple of that relocation beyond the site gloss. Ask them to explain a current walk that did not go to strategy and what they transformed. Ask how they would certainly heat up a high energy pet dog on a moist day to stay clear of getting too hot. Ask for a brief demo of how they manage a pull toward a squirrel. Solutions that sound resided in are what you want.

Watch for these red flags that typically predict frustrations later on:

  • Vague or prideful responses regarding insurance coverage or emergency planning.
  • Reliance on aversive tools without your authorization, such as slipping prong collars or utilizing leash stands out as a default.
  • Overpromising, like walking 4 or five dogs at once on midtown sidewalks, or assuring that a reactive dog will certainly be great in huge teams within a week.
  • Thin communication, late replies throughout the trial week, or irregular walk home windows with no heads up.
  • Indifference to weather changes, like demanding lengthy lunchtime asphalt strolls throughout a heat advisory.

Three common scenarios, and exactly how a good dog walker adapts

A six month old pup in Lakewood. Potty training is mainly there, but lunch break is shaky. The walker establishes 2 midday sees for the very first 2 weeks, a 15 minute alleviation at 11 holiday dog walking rates and a 20 min walk at 2 with 2 simple training video games. They shorten the walk on hot days, provide water, and log each pee and poop. Within a month, the proprietor goes down to one 30 minute noontime check out since the pet is accurately holding in between 10 and 3.

A reactive shepherd near Southpoint. The pet lunges at bikes and joggers. The pedestrian selects quieter roads at 10 a.m., after that utilizes distance from triggers, rewarding check ins. They keep the pet beside convenience and never push through reactivity. Over four to six weeks, the guard can pass a jogger at 30 feet without barking, then 20 feet. Not ideal, yet practical, and the owner feels risk-free again.

An elderly beagle downtown with creaky hips. Staircases are tough in the early morning. The walker times sees after pain medications, makes use of a rear harness aid if required, and chooses level loops with turf shoulders. They massage paws after icy days and spray a little water on the belly during heat. The pet returns home content, not hopping, and the owner's vet reports steady weight and much better mobility.

Working connection, just how to make it smooth

Start with a clear account. Consist of regimens, wellness notes, where the harness hangs, just how to stay clear of the neighbor's yappy fence line, and your pet's favorite benefit. Pedestrians relocate quicker and more secure when they do not have to presume. Set realistic time windows and select a vital access system that does not need day-to-day sychronisation. Throughout the first week, examine the application notes, respond if something looks off, and deal responses. 2 or 3 tiny course modifications at an early stage prevent longer term drift from your preferences.

If your schedule whipsaws, package modifications when you can. Lots of pet strolling solutions prepare courses the night prior to. A single message that contains all week updates beats a string of private pings. Keep emergency contacts present. If you recognize a storm is coming, preauthorize the pedestrian to shorten exterior time and prolong interior enrichment, like nose deal with a couple of treats concealed under cups.

Most canines take advantage of consistency, yet a small amount of novelty maintains them interested. Weekly or more, ask the walker to select a new loop or add a short pattern video game at the end. That tweak stimulates the brain without ramping arousal.

The role of training and boundaries

A dog walker is not a substitute for a trainer, however a competent pedestrian enhances the policies you set. If you are teaching loosened leash strolling, agree on signs and rewards. If your pet can not welcome on leash, the pedestrian must mirror that border and reroute with a simple rest and treat as various other dogs pass. When every person manages the pet dog the same way, progression sticks.

Be thoughtful concerning gear. Harnesses that clip at the upper body can decrease pulling for some pet dogs and get worse motion for others. Collars ought to have 2 finger slack, harness bands ought to sit clear of shoulder blades. Share your vet's recommendations on orthopedic problems or any leash and harness safety restrictions. The best pet dog pedestrians durham has will certainly ask to readjust the plan if they see chafing or if stride modifications after 15 minutes.

Where to look, and just how to verify

Referrals still beat algorithms. Ask your veterinarian tech, your next-door neighbor with the calm Lab, your structure supervisor. A lot of the constant pet walking services Durham NC locals count on keep a low marketing profile due to the fact that they are scheduled with word of mouth. If you do look online, incorporate "pet walking service Durham" with your area name. Read evaluations, however weigh specifics over star counts. A review that states, "They rerouted to color throughout last week's warm advisory and brought extra water for my pug," deserves ten generic raves.

Schedule a paid test week before making a regular monthly dedication. Schedule three to 5 visits throughout various times. Evaluate preparation within the agreed window, the top quality of notes, just how your pet greets the walker on day three, and whether tiny problems get smoothed rapidly. If your pet dog returns loosened up, beverages water, then snoozes, you are on track. If your canine spins at the door for an hour after the pedestrian leaves, or you see placing sensitivity, change or reconsider.

Weather, safety, and sensible expectations

Durham summer seasons will check also fit dogs. On 95 level days with high moisture, your canine does not need range, they require secure engagement. A 15 to 20 minute shaded sniff walk with water and a cool towel inside is often the appropriate call. Great solutions connect these adjustments and do not excuse safeguarding your canine. Also, during thunderstorms, several pet dogs stop at the door. Compeling them out produces fights. A walker must pivot to interior enrichment, potty preferably throughout time-outs, and maintain you informed.

Traffic and building change quickly around here. Pathway closures turn up without caution. I have actually turned a scheduled loophole into a cul-de-sac figure eight just to stay clear of a loud backhoe. The metric is not miles, it is high quality. If your pet dog obtains 5 solid mins of loose leash practice, three tranquil direct exposures to delivery van, and a clean potty break, that is a successful midday see on a noisy day.
